WCAF 22nd Annual Livestock Premium Auction

Friday, July 17, 2026­ • 6:00 p.m.
Hog Show Ring

Open to Warren County Beef, Sheep, Swine or Boer Goat Exhibitors who show the same species in both 4H & Junior Shows at the fair.

Rules & Regulations

  1. Exhibitors who participate in the Livestock Auction MUST BE PRESENT at the time of the auction to represent themselves and their animal. Animals will not be on display.
     

    2. Each exhibitor is limited to one entry in auction.

    3. Animals will remain the property of the exhibitor and will not become the property of the winning bidders.

    4. All proceeds go to individual exhibitors. No commission will be taken by the Warren County Fair Association. Checks will not be released to the exhibitor until funds have been collected from buyer.

    5. Successful exhibitors and bidders will be recognized in the following year’s fair book.

    6. To be eligible you must show in the 4-H show and the Jr. Show.

    7. Each exhibitor is required to volunteer 2 hrs. in the 4-H food stand during the fair.
